Apps for Home Productivity

If you’re looking for ways to be more productive at home, there are plenty of apps that can help. From to-do list apps to organization tools, there’s an app for almost everything. Here are some of the best productivity apps for your home.

Todoist is a great to-do list app that helps you keep track of everything you need to do. You can create tasks and subtasks, set due dates and priorities, and even share your lists with others. Todoist also has a handy widget so you can see your upcoming tasks at a glance.

Another great app for staying organized is Evernote. With Evernote, you can take notes, create To-Do lists, and save web articles and images for later. You can also sync your Evernote account across all of your devices, so you always have access to your notes no matter where you are.

If you’re looking for an app to help you manage your time better, try RescueTime. RescueTime runs in the background on your computer or phone and tracks how much time you spend on each website or app. It then gives you a report of where you spend most of your time so you can make changes if necessary.

-What are Some Good Apps for Staying Productive at Home

Assuming you would like a list of apps that can help with productivity, here are ten popular options: 1. Evernote – Evernote is a cross-platform app that helps users capture and organize ideas, thoughts, and to-do lists. It’s great for both work and personal use, and has features like syncing across devices, setting reminders, and adding multimedia notes.

2. Todoist – Todoist is another cross-platform app that helps users manage their tasks and to-do lists. It’s perfect for those who need help staying organized and on top of their commitments. It also has features like syncing across devices, sharing lists with others, and setting deadlines/reminders.

3. Trello – Trello is a visual organization tool that uses “boards” to help users keep track of projects or goals. It’s great for both individual and team use, as boards can be shared with others for collaboration. Boards can also be customized with different colors, labels, due dates, etc., to fit each user’s needs.

4. AnyDo – AnyDo is an iOS productivity app that helps users manage their tasks and calendar events in one place. It includes features like task prioritization, subtasks, recurring tasks, notifications & reminders, etc., to help users stay on top of their commitments. 5 Forest – Forest is an iOS app that helps people stay focused by planting virtual trees; the more time you spend on your phone without using other apps

(i), the more your tree grows (ii). The app also allows you to set timers and create goals so you can better monitor your progress over time .

6 Freedom – Freedom is an app available on multiple platforms that helps people block distractions so they can better focus on what they need to do . This can be especially helpful when working from home , as there are often more distractions around the house than in an office setting . Freedom allows you to block specific websites , apps , or even the internet itself for certain periods of time , so you can stay focused on what’s important .

7 Momentum – Momentum is a Chrome extension that replaces your new tab page with a personalized dashboard featuring your To-Do List , weather forecast , motivation quote of the day , etc . Having all of this information readily available whenever you open a new tab can help keep you focused on what needs to get done ; plus , it’s just really satisfying seeing everything crossed off your To-Do List at the end of the day ! 8 Cold Turkey Blocker – Cold Turkey Blocker is another distraction-blocking app available on multiple platforms ; however , it takes things one step further by not only blocking access to distracting websites & apps but also preventing you from opening them in the first place ! So if there’s something particularly tempting that you know you shouldn’t be spending time on , Cold Turkey Blocker will make sure you don’t give in to temptation . 9 SelfControl – SelfControl is similar to Cold Turkey Blocker in terms of its functionality ; however , it only works on Mac computers . If staying productive at home means avoiding distractions from social media sites or news outlets , then SelfControl could be a good option for helping achieve this goal .
